Committee on Children and Adolescents

Mission: 
1) Keep  a pulse on what is happening regarding child and adolescent services in New York; identify issues that need further information and review, such as problems with getting medication approval for children, issues on inadequate supply of ADHD medications, problems with insurance denial of care 
2) Review and provide input to Area II regarding issues relevant to NYS child services including a review of the new OMH plan to change current services and  set up OMH  Regional  Centers of excellence. TO review these plans and it impact on services through out the state
3) review  and discuss new state initiatives such as I Stop Law and Safe Act 
4) Develop a network of child and adolescent colleague so we can learn from each other regarding psychiatric issues of care and practice, including  electronic prescribing, coding, EMR .... Support colleagues when essential services are facing closure such as when Inpatient unit at Stony Brook was threatened
5) Foster interest in Child Psychiatry
6) Better integrate with AACAP regarding advocacy and training issues
